National Citizen Survey: McKinney on par with national benchmarks; utilities, mobility and water resources flagged for attention

A Polco presenter told the McKinney City Council that the 2025 National Citizen Survey finds the city close to national benchmarks overall but identified gaps in utilities, mobility and water resources and noted declines since 2023 in several areas.

Polco representative Tobin McCarron presented results of the 2025 National Citizen Survey to the McKinney City Council on June 17, summarizing comparisons with national benchmarks and trends since the city's last survey in 2023.

McCarron told the council that the survey uses a two-pronged approach: a probability-based mailed sample and an open, nonprobability online sample. He said the probability sample produced 268 responses (about a 5% response rate), which Polco weighted to the city's demographics using the 2020 Census and the 2023 American Community Survey to produce statistically representative estimates.
